Understanding Loan Interest Rate
A loan interest rate is the percentage of the loan amount that the borrower must pay in addition to the principal amount. It is usually expressed as an annual percentage rate (APR) and can be fixed or variable. Fixed interest rates remain constant throughout the loan term, while variable interest rates can change over time based on market conditions.
Simple Interest Method
The simplest way to calculate loan interest rate is using the simple interest method. This method calculates interest based on the principal amount and the time period for which the loan is taken. The formula for simple interest is:
Interest = Principal x Rate x Time
Where:
– Principal is the amount of money borrowed.
– Rate is the annual interest rate (expressed as a decimal).
– Time is the duration of the loan in years.
For example, if you borrow $10,000 at an annual interest rate of 5% for 2 years, the interest you would pay is:
Interest = $10,000 x 0.05 x 2 = $1,000
Compound Interest Method
The compound interest method is more complex than the simple interest method. It takes into account the interest that has been earned or paid during the loan term. The formula for compound interest is:
A = P(1 + r/n)^(nt)
Where:
– A is the future value of the loan, including interest.
– P is the principal amount.
– r is the annual interest rate (expressed as a decimal).
– n is the number of times that interest is compounded per year.
– t is the number of years.

APR Calculation
The annual percentage rate (APR) is a more comprehensive measure of the cost of borrowing. It includes not only the interest rate but also other fees and charges associated with the loan. The formula for calculating APR is:
APR = (Total Interest + Other Fees) / (Principal x Time) x 100
For example, if you borrow $10,000 with an interest rate of 5% and pay $200 in other fees over 2 years, the APR would be:
APR = ($1,000 + $200) / ($10,000 x 2) x 100 = 6%
